ios软件开发 ios软件开发用什么语言

小编 2023-10-29 63

iOS软件开发及iOS软件开发用什么语言

iOS软件开发

随着智能手机的普及,iOS系统成为了全球最流行的移动操作系统之一。iOS软件开发指的是针对iOS系统的应用程序的开发过程。开发iOS应用程序可以为用户提供丰富的功能和出色的用户体验。iOS软件开发包括设计、编码、测试和发布应用程序。在开发过程中,开发者需要选择合适的开发语言、开发工具和框架。

ios软件开发 ios软件开发用什么语言

iOS软件开发用什么语言

在iOS软件开发中,开发者可以使用多种编程语言进行开发。以下是目前最主要的两种语言:

1. Objective-C: Objective-C是一种面向对象的编程语言,是iOS系统开发的主要语言。Objective-C是由C语言衍生而来的,它添加了面向对象的特性,如封装、继承和多态。Objective-C具有较长的历史,是iOS系统早期的主要开发语言。许多iOS应用程序仍然使用Objective-C进行开发。Objective-C使用起来相对复杂,但它具有强大的功能和广泛的开发资源。

2. Swift: Swift是由苹果公司于2014年推出的全新编程语言。Swift具有现代化的语法和强大的功能,被认为是Objective-C的继任者。Swift更加易学易用,代码更简洁,同时具备高效性能。Swift还引入了一些新的特性,如类型推断、可选类型和自动内存管理,使开发更加方便和安全。随着时间的推移,Swift在iOS开发中越来越受欢迎,并逐渐取代了Objective-C。

除了Objective-C和Swift,还有其他一些编程语言可以用于iOS开发,如C++和JavaScript。C++可以用于编写高性能的底层代码,而JavaScript可以用于开发跨平台的移动应用程序。Objective-C和Swift仍然是iOS开发的主流语言,具有更广泛的支持和开发资源。

iOS软件开发可以使用Objective-C和Swift等编程语言。Objective-C是iOS早期的主要开发语言,而Swift是一种现代化、易学易用的语言,逐渐取代了Objective-C。选择使用哪种语言取决于开发者的经验、项目需求和个人喜好。

The End
微信